As part of our ongoing Enviroschools journey, we were lucky to receive a dwarf apple tree last month for our garden from Vic at Environment Canterbury 🌱
To celebrate this special addition to our outdoor space, we held a small tree planting ceremony. Earlier in the day, a group of tamariki worked together to dig a hole ready for the new tree 🍎
As we gathered together, Kaiako Jess shared a karakia:
Whakataka te hau ki te uru,
Whakataka te hau ki te tonga.
Kia mākinakina ki uta,
Kia mātaratara ki tai.
E hī ake ana te atatū.
He tio, he huka, he hauhu.
Haumi e! Hui e! Tāiki e!
As we gently placed the tree into the ground, the tamariki made a promise to it:
"We welcome you to our preschool. We promise to water you. Please grow tall for the birds."
The children carefully covered the roots with soil before stepping back to admire their work. We look forward to caring for our apple tree and watching it grow alongside our tamariki for many years to come.

Our Selwyn House Preschool kaiako Megan Johnston took part in an inspirational professional development opportunity delivered over term break by the Primary Drama Collective 🎭
The "Auaha: Unleashing Literacy through Creativity" conference was held in the Selwyn House School Performing Arts Atrium.
Megan is looking forward to sharing many fun new ideas with ngā tamariki.
"We explored how drama and pretend play bring stories to life. When children act out different roles, they naturally develop their oral language skills - picking up new words and learning what they mean through active play. It’s a super fun, hands-on way to build a strong foundation for reading and writing.
"Get ready for lots of storytelling, starting this week with 'Goldilocks and the Three Bears.'" 🐻

During today's School Group session, ngā tamariki explored the conceptual understanding of measurement. They began by brainstorming different ways they could measure, and then came up with ideas of what they could measure, heights, hands, feet, ingredients for baking, and building materials. The next step was hands-on exploration, weighing classroom objects, measuring heights, and comparing painted prints.
Demonstrating the PYP Approaches to Learning, Thinking and Research skills, they made predictions, investigated and acted as reflective learners by drawing evidence-based conclusions afterward. Through these experiences, the children are not only growing their knowledge about mathematical relationships in quantity and space, they are also building self-efficacy by seeing themselves as capable researchers and thinkers.

This afternoon the running shoes were on and the spirits were high as ngā tamariki took part in our second annual Selwyn House Preschool Cross Country.
After the success of last year’s event, the children were excited and ready to race again! This year saw slightly different race rules, to give ngā tamariki a new challenge; run as many times around Acland Field as you can! Teachers were stationed to give children a stamp for each lap they did.
What amazing runners we have, ngā tamariki demonstrated such grit and determination. We awarded four trophies to those who demonstrated exceptional sportsmanship, tried their hardest and had a great sense of pride in their efforts.

In May 2001, construction of Selwyn House Preschool was underway. Acclaimed children’s author Margaret Mahy would assist with the grand opening in September. And the appointment of experienced educator Rachel Sanderson (now Johnston) received rave reviews in The Press 🗞️
“The programmes will have an emphasis on partnerships between the children, parents and teachers. Not only is it an important part of the Reggio Emilia philosophy, but it’s the key in the development and happiness of the child.”
Today we acknowledge the extraordinary dedication of Rachel Johnston, who has served Selwyn House Preschool for 25 years.
On behalf of our Selwyn House School and Preschool teams and wider community, thank you Rachel for leading with manaakitanga. The joy of our tamariki learning and growing is truly your legacy.
